Mobile Banking Limitations Sample Clauses

Mobile Banking Limitations. Processing of payment and transfer instructions may take longer using Mobile Banking. We will not be liable for any delays or failures in your ability to access Mobile Banking service or in your receipt of any text messages. Internet access and messaging are subject to effective transmission from your network provider and processing by your mobile device, as well as delays and interruptions in the Internet. Mobile Banking is provided by us on an AS IS, AS AVAILABLE basis.

Mobile Banking Limitations. Mobile Banking cannot be used to: ▪ Initiate funds transfers to other financial institutions. ▪ Initiate payments or transfers to new payees or to create new payees. ▪ Initiate transfers to other members’ accounts at the Credit Union unless the accounts have been linked in-Branch. Linking accounts can only be done in-Branch.
Mobile Banking Limitations. Bank has no liability if Customer breaches any of these Mobile Banking terms. Bank is not responsible for the security, availability, or operation of Customer’s Mobile Devices or mobile networks. Access to or use of Mobile Banking may be interrupted, blocked, or restricted due to (for example) technical or other problems with Mobile Banking or Customer’s Mobile Devices or networks, possible security breaches, and/or government requirements; data may be lost and/or data may not be received, not timely received, not acted upon and/or not timely acted upon by Bank; and Bank is not liable for damages, losses, and expenses as a result thereof.
Mobile Banking Limitations. It is important that you understand the limitations of the Mobile Services, including but not limited to the following:  The balance of the Accounts may change at any time as we process items and fees against them, and the information provided to you through the Mobile Services may become quickly outdated. Financial information obtained through the Mobile Services (including, without limitation, any text message alerts) reflects the most recent Account information available through the Mobile Services and may not be accurate or current. You agree that neither we nor our Licensors will be liable for any errors or delays in the content, or for any actions taken in reliance thereon.  Because the Mobile Services are accessible only through your Mobile Device, your access to the Mobile Services may be limited by the service provided by your telecommunications carrier.  There may be technical or other difficulties related to the Mobile Services. These difficulties may result in loss of data, personalized settings or other the Mobile Services interruptions. We do not assume any responsibility for the timeliness, deletion, or misdelivery of any user data, failure to store user data, communications or personalized settings in connection with your use of a Mobile Service; nor for the delivery or the accuracy of any information requested or provided through a Mobile Service. We reserve the right to block access or delete the Mobile Service software from your Mobile Device if we or our Licensor have reason to believe you are misusing a Mobile Service or otherwise not complying with this Addendum, or have reason to suspect your Mobile Device has been infected with malicious software or virus. Mobile Banking Limitations. 1. Neither we nor our service providers can always foresee or anticipate technical or other difficulties related to Mobile Banking. These difficulties may result in loss of data, personalization settings, or other Mobile Banking interruptions. Neither we nor any of our service providers assumes responsibility for any disclosure of account information to third parties by someone other than us or our service providers, or the timeliness, deletion, misdelivery or failure to store any user data, communications or personalization settings in connection with your use of Mobile Banking.
Mobile Banking Limitations. The availability, timeliness and proper functioning of Mobile Banking depends on many factors, including your Wireless Device location, wireless network availability and signal strength, and the proper functioning and configuration of hardware, software and your Wireless Device. Neither we nor any of our service providers shall be liable for any loss or damage caused by any unavailability or improper functioning of Mobile Banking, or for any actions taken in reliance thereon, for any reason, including service interruptions, inaccuracies, delays, loss of data, or loss of personalized settings.

Mobile Banking Limitations. We reserve the right to limit the type of accounts available through the Mobile Banking as well as the number and amount of transactions. We have the right to refuse or reject any transaction you request and we also reserve the right to modify the Service at any time. The Credit Union is not responsible if Mobile Banking is not accessible in any way or by any reason by your wireless carrier or is not supported by your mobile device. EquiShare Credit Union reserves the right to decline use of the Service. Mobile Banking Transfers You may use Mobile Banking to make payments and transfer funds between eligible EquiShare Credit Union accounts. You may not access funds not in your name or at another financial institution using Mobile Banking. You must have sufficient funds available in the selected account at the time of the transfer request, including any available overdraft protection. Unless you have opted out of our overdraft programs you agree to be charged any associated fees and to bring any overdrawn account to a positive balance within the previously disclosed period of time. Federal regulations limit the types of withdrawals from some accounts. Please consult your Membership agreement and disclosures. You agree to confirm the completion of transactions before accessing the funds. Mobile Banking Errors. Errors involving Mobile Banking transactions are covered by the Error Resolution previously outlined. Mobile Banking Termination
